#675642 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#675642 is composed of 40.4% red, 33.7%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.5% magenta, 35.9%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 32.4 degrees, a saturation of 21.9% and a lightness of 33.1%. #675642 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ceac84 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#675642 color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#675642 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#675642 has RGB values of R:103, G:86,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.36,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6772290.
